| 520 | _aConsiders the rise in popularity of roped access, or abseiling, for carrying out building inspection and maintenance in difficult to get to places, the threat this trend poses to more traditional access equipment suppliers and the role of Industrial Rope Access Trade Association (IRATA) guidelines. | ||
